|
@@ 320-327 (lines=8) @@
|
| 317 |
|
} else { |
| 318 |
|
|
| 319 |
|
// define some actions to be used |
| 320 |
|
$disableAction = function ($uid, IUser $user) use ($output) { |
| 321 |
|
if ($user->isEnabled()) { |
| 322 |
|
$user->setEnabled(false); |
| 323 |
|
$output->writeln("$uid, {$user->getDisplayName()}, {$user->getEMailAddress()} disabled"); |
| 324 |
|
} else { |
| 325 |
|
$output->writeln("$uid, {$user->getDisplayName()}, {$user->getEMailAddress()} skipped, already disabled"); |
| 326 |
|
} |
| 327 |
|
}; |
| 328 |
|
$deleteAction = function ($uid, IUser $user) use ($output) { |
| 329 |
|
$user->delete(); |
| 330 |
|
$output->writeln("$uid, {$user->getDisplayName()}, {$user->getEMailAddress()} deleted"); |
|
@@ 406-413 (lines=8) @@
|
| 403 |
|
$output->writeln('Re-enabling accounts:'); |
| 404 |
|
|
| 405 |
|
$this->doActionForAccountUids($reappearedUsers, |
| 406 |
|
function ($uid, IUser $user) use ($output) { |
| 407 |
|
if ($user->isEnabled()) { |
| 408 |
|
$output->writeln("$uid, {$user->getDisplayName()}, {$user->getEMailAddress()} skipped, already enabled"); |
| 409 |
|
} else { |
| 410 |
|
$user->setEnabled(true); |
| 411 |
|
$output->writeln("$uid, {$user->getDisplayName()}, {$user->getEMailAddress()} enabled"); |
| 412 |
|
} |
| 413 |
|
}, |
| 414 |
|
function ($uid) use ($output) { |
| 415 |
|
$output->writeln("$uid not enabled (no existing account found)"); |
| 416 |
|
} |